15、each of the chests, selected as a sample unit from the lot, shall be thoroughly examined to determine the mating and fitting of the component parts by erecting and collapsing the chest. Each chest shall be collapsed and erected as specified in 658140, Sheet 1. The list of defects, Table V, shall be

16、used to enumerate the defects found. TABLE V LIST OF DEFECTS FOR OPERATION a. b. c. Front, top, or sides do not retate freely on its hinge pin. The hook lock and eye lock do not mate. Realignment of any part, undue force, use of mechanical means or tools is necessary to erect or collapse any chest.

17、Lid binds on opening or closing.
